Młynne [ˈmwɨnnɛ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Limanowa, within Limanowa County, Lesser Poland Voivodeship, in southern Poland. It lies approximately 6 kilometres (4 mi) north of Limanowa and 49 km (30 mi) south-east of the regional capital Kraków.[1]

The village has a population of 1,500.
